I have a dash camera and a hard wire kit with the fuse block. Nice and clean install ability. I saw another member post about fuse 3 in the inside fuse block was a source he used for power.

My issues is on my 2022 BS- BB, the power cycles off and back on any time the engine restarts after a auto on/ off at a red light. I have no intention to stop using the auto start/ stop, and don’t want to forget to hit the button and the video cut off when needed at a red light.
Is anyone familiar with a fuse that only has power with the ignition on…. Doesn’t do a quick cycle when the auto start/ stop is in play…. ?

i believe the rear cargo 12v cuts off after a short time but I can’t identify the fuse for it from the manual So far.

Have you tested to see if the slot stays hot when the engine shuts off? Some cameras sense voltage to enter parking mode. The system is 14 v with the engine running and 12 v with only battery power. Check your camera to see if you can disable parking mode.

Did you check your camera to see if it has a parking mode? If so, did you disable it?

I have abandoned the hard wire kit and have it plugged into the standard 12v below the radio. After a little time it does shut off.
Yes, this makes sense (assuming I'm correct about the way your camera switches to parking mode). The hardwire kit includes the voltage sensor. When you use the 12v outlet plug there is no voltage sensor, so the camera never enters parking mode.

Did you test the circuit to see if power is available in ACC mode (engine not running)? Slot 3 in my car is powered any time the vehicle electrical system is on whether the engine is running or not.
